- About IC24
Integrated Care 24 (IC24) is a not‑for‑profit social enterprise delivering innovative and patient‑focused primary care services.
We provide services to over 6 million patients, including GP‑led out‑of‑hours services, NHS 111, primary care and secondary care support services.
